Tabla de contenido:
2025 Autor: John Day | [email protected]. Última modificación: 2025-01-13 06:57
El siguiente proyecto es un convertidor SPEIC que es un convertidor Buck / Boost no inversor que sube y baja el voltaje.
El sistema permitirá al usuario ajustar la salida a un valor deseado; el sistema de control de lazo cerrado estabilizará este valor a pesar de cambiar los valores de carga y voltaje de entrada.
Este proyecto es una implementación de un diseño en el que trabajó Abdelrahman Sada utilizando MATLAB-Simulink.
Especificaciones del diseño:
- Frecuencia = 10 KHz
- Voltaje de entrada = 3-30 V
- Voltaje de salida = 0-25 V
- Corriente máxima = 1A
- Este proyecto lo realiza nuestro pasante: Abderahman Sada.
- Para más información: [email protected]
Paso 1: Obtenga los componentes
En caso de que desee crear su propio SPEIC, necesitará lo siguiente:
- Mosfet de potencia: IRF720.
- Canal P: ZVP2106A.
- Canal N 820K.
- Potenciómetro.
- Condensadores: 470 uF y 100uF.
- Diodo
- Inductores: 2x100UH.
- Arduino UNO.
- Terminal 2xScrew.
- Disipador de calor.
Paso 2: construye tu circuito
Recomendamos construirlo en un protoboard al principio y después de terminar todos los pasos, soldarlo a través de un stripboard.
También es una buena idea montar Power Mosfet en un disipador de calor.
Paso 3: Cargue el código
Sube el código usando Arduino IDE.
Una vez finalizada la carga, vaya a Herramientas y luego Plotter serial, desde esta pantalla puede ver el Voltaje de salida, que se puede ajustar usando el potenciómetro después de conectar el circuito a la fuente.
Antes de cargar, asegúrese de tener las siguientes bibliotecas:
1. biblioteca PWM; puede agregarlo desde Sketch, Incluir biblioteca, Agregar biblioteca ZIP. (PWM-Master.zip)
2. biblioteca PIDController; puede agregarlo desde Sketch, Incluir biblioteca, Administrar bibliotecas, buscarlo e instalarlo.
Se adjunta el código.
Referencias:
1.
2.